迁移我的 MacBook 后,我发现我错过了该命令gpg
。
当我想要安装时,它抛出了这个错误rvm
⋊> ~ gpg 15:39:34
dyld: Library not loaded: /usr/local/opt/gettext/lib/libintl.8.dylib
Referenced from: /usr/local/bin/gpg
Reason: image not found
fish: 'gpg' terminated by signal SIGABRT (Abort)
我尝试过以下方法来修复它,但是都没有用。
brew upgrade gnupg
brew unlink gnupg
brew link gnupg
此外,我没有这个文件夹/usr/local/opt/gettext/.
我需要安装一些东西来解决这个问题吗?
更新
我把输出放在brew doctor
这里
https://gist.github.com/fifiteen82726/fae106018447e868d64ff1a9d3e6266a
答案1
看起来您似乎遗漏了gettext
brew 中的某些内容。由于您提到您正在迁移,因此似乎您仅部分迁移了 中的内容/usr/local
。可能还缺少其他库/二进制文件/等。
尝试从...开始brew install gettext
,看看能带你到达哪里。